Child protection policy

FBS’ takes seriously its responsibility to protect and safeguard the welfare of children and young people in its care. An effective whole-school child protection policy is one which provides clear direction to staff and others about expected behavior when dealing with child protection issues.

The purpose of this policy is to provide staff and employees with the guidance they need in order to keep children safe and secure in our school, to inform parents and guardians how we will safeguard their children whilst they are in our care, and ensure that FBS/FBSG has student protection measures in place:

  • Protect students while in the school’s care from all acts and omissions constituting physical abuse, emotional abuse, neglect, and bullying.
  • Identify and support those students who may have suffered such abuse or neglect, as strongly enforced by the Kuwait Child Protection Law 21/2015 the Kuwait National Protection Program (government agency) and Kuwait Ministry of the Interior
  • Emphasize that all FBS/FBSG employees and school staff are mandated reporters of cases of abuse and/or suspected abuse inside and outside the school.
  • Define duties and responsibilities of School Principals and school staff for responding to suspected cases of child abuse and/or neglect.
